Conclusion
Shimano Twin Power XD A C 3000 HGX clearly outshines Shimano Ocea Conquest HG 201X, offering significantly better performance in gear ratio (6.0:1) and maximum drag (9kg / 19,84lbs). While Shimano Ocea Conquest HG 201X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Twin Power XD A C 3000 HGX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
